Description
The drag-and-drop classes that control the styles are not properly being updated when keystrokes are used to move focus. As a result, styles are not being properly updated, and the most-recently-dragged item remains styled with a grey background even when keystrokes have moved focus to another item.
The keystroke handling code needs to be aware of the drag-and-drop classes, and update them accordingly. This probably involves removing them, but it might require moving them to the newly selected item.
